Advanced (WMS) market analysis | revenue trends and price momentum remain in focus. Advanced Drainage Systems (WMS) closed at $137.54, gaining 3.41% in the latest session. The move comes after the stock held above key support near $130.66, while resistance stands at $144.42. The price action suggests near-term momentum could continue if volume remains supportive.

In the broader infrastructure and water management sector, companies like WMS may benefit from ongoing public and private spending on drainage and wastewater systems. The company’s positioning as a leading provider of thermoplastic corrugated pipe and water management solutions places it in a segment that has seen steady demand from construction and agricultural end markets. Additionally, recent commentary around federal infrastructure initiatives could be contributing to positive sentiment. However, it is important to note that the exact drivers of this specific price move are not confirmed; broader market trends, sector rotations, or company-specific news flow may all have played a role. The stock’s ability to sustain gains will likely depend on whether the buying interest continues at these levels.

From a technical perspective, WMS has bounced from support near $130.66, a level that has held multiple times over recent weeks. The current price of $137.54 sits roughly midway between that support and the resistance zone at $144.42.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is likely in the mid-50s to low-60s range, indicating mildly bullish momentum without entering overbought territory. Moving averages may be in a mixed configuration, with the 50-day moving average potentially acting as a near-term resistance point around the $140 area. The price action shows a series of higher lows since testing the $130.66 support, which could be interpreted as a constructive short-term pattern. A break above $144.42 would open the path toward higher resistance levels, while a fall back below $130.66 might signal renewed weakness. Volume patterns during the advance will be important to monitor—sustained above-average volume on up days would strengthen the bullish case.

Looking ahead, WMS may attempt to challenge resistance at $144.42 in the coming sessions if buying momentum continues. A successful move above that level could lead to a test of the next psychological barrier near $150. Conversely, failure to hold above $137 and a return toward $130.66 could indicate that the rally is running out of steam. Key factors that could influence performance include upcoming earnings reports, changes in infrastructure spending policies, and broader economic data affecting construction activity. Interest rate movements also play a role, as higher rates can slow development projects and impact demand for drainage products. Traders may watch for volume confirmation and price action near the $140–$144 zone to gauge strength. It remains uncertain whether the current move represents the start of a sustained uptrend or a temporary rebound within a broader range.
